Compare all specifications:
1959 BMW Isetta | 1954 Hudson Metropolitan | |
Make | BMW | Hudson |
Model | Isetta | Metropolitan |
Year Released | 1959 | 1954 |
Engine Position | Rear | Front |
Engine Size | 247 cc | 1200 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 1 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| single | in-line |
Horse Power | 13 HP | 41 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Vehicle Weight | 360 kg | 810 kg |
Vehicle Length | 2300 mm | 3800 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1390 mm | 1570 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1350 mm | 1450 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 1510 mm | 2170 mm |
